The Prebiotic Ingredient market within the Food Ingredients industry is a rapidly growing sector. Prebiotic ingredients are non-digestible carbohydrates that act as a food source for beneficial bacteria in the gut. They are used to improve digestive health, boost immunity, and reduce inflammation. Prebiotic ingredients are often derived from natural sources such as chicory root, Jerusalem artichoke, and garlic. They are also available in a variety of forms, including powders, capsules, and tablets.
The demand for prebiotic ingredients is driven by the increasing awareness of the importance of gut health and the growing demand for natural and organic food products. The market is expected to continue to grow as more consumers become aware of the health benefits of prebiotic ingredients.
Some companies in the Prebiotic Ingredient market include Cargill, Tate & Lyle, Ingredion, Kerry Group, and DuPont Nutrition & Health. Show Less Read more
